基于IGF-1R/PI3K/AKT的益气固表丸对慢性阻塞性肺疾病模型大鼠的影响及作用机制研究 |
Effects and Mechanism of Yiqi Gubiao Pills on Chronic Obstructive Pulmonary Disease in Model Rats Based on IGF-1R/PI3K/AKT Signaling Pathway |

中文摘要: |
目的:益气固表丸对慢性阻塞性肺疾病(COPD)有明显的治疗作用,但具体作用机制尚不清楚。本研究旨在探讨益气固表丸对脂多糖(LPS)联合烟雾暴露构建慢性阻塞性肺病模型大鼠的治疗作用机制。方法:通过大鼠气管内灌注LPS和吸入香烟烟雾构建慢性阻塞性肺病模型,同时给予模型大鼠低、中、高剂量益气固表丸治疗14 d。观察呼吸参数及肺组织病理变化。采用酶联免疫吸附试验测定支气管肺泡灌洗液(BALF)及血清胰岛素样生长因子1型受体(IGF-1R)、白细胞介素-1β(IL-1β)、IL-10水平。采用蛋白质印迹法检测大鼠肺组织样品中胰岛素样生长因子1受体(IGF-1R)/PI3K/AKT信号通路组分的磷酸化状态。结果:与对照组和低剂量益气组比较,大剂量益气固表丸治疗可显著改善COPD大鼠呼吸参数,减轻肺损伤和炎症,降低BALF和血清炎症介质水平。此外,高剂量益气固表丸干预的COPD大鼠肺组织标本中磷酸化IGF-1R、p-PI3K、p-AKT、p-GSK3、p-mTOR蛋白水平显著降低。结论:益气固表丸对COPD有明显的治疗作用,可能与靶向IGF-1R/PI3K/AKT信号通路有关。 |
English Summary: |
Yiqi Gubiao Pills have a definite therapeutic effect on chronic obstructive pulmonary disease(COPD),but the specific mechanism of action remains unclear.This study aimed to explore the therapeutic mechanism of Yiqi Gubiao Pills in the treatment of COPD in rats induced by lipopolysaccharide(LPS) combined with cigarette smoke exposure.Methods:The COPD model was induced in rats by intratracheal instillation of LPS and cigarette smoke inhalation.Meanwhile,the model rats were treated with low-,medium-,or high-dose Yiqi Gubiao Pills for 14 days.The respiratory parameters and pulmonary histopathological changes were examined.The enzyme-linked immunosorbent assay(ELISA) was conducted to measure the levels of insulin-like growth factor 1 receptor(IGF-1R),interleukin(IL)-1β,and IL-10 in bronchoalveolar lavage fluid(BALF) and serum.Western blot was used to determine the phosphorylation of the components in the IGF-1R/PI3K/AKT signaling pathway in the lung tissues of rats.Results:Compared with the control group and the low-dose Yiqi Gubiao Pills group,the high-dose Yiqi Gubiao Pills group showed significantly improved respiratory parameters,alleviated lung injury and inflammation,and reduced proinflammatory cytokine levels in BALF and serum of COPD rats.Furthermore,high-dose Yiqi Gubiao Pills could significantly reduce the protein levels of phosphorylated(p)-IGF-1R,p-PI3K,p-AKT,p-GSK3,and p-mTOR in the lung tissues of COPD rats.Conclusion:Yiqi Gubiao Pills have a definite therapeutic effect on COPD,and the mechanism may be related to targeting the IGF-1R/PI3K/AKT signaling pathway. |
